The Importance of the ⁤Order of Draw in Phlebotomy

The order of ⁤draw ensures that blood samples are collected in a manner that reduces the risk ‍of contamination and​ minimizes interference with laboratory​ results.‌ each tube has a specific additive that can interact with othre ‌substances, possibly leading​ to inaccurate test results. Therefore, adhering ‍to the correct order of draw ⁤is essential for:

  • Quality control of laboratory specimens
  • Accurate diagnostic outcomes
  • Reducing the need for repeat collections

Order of Draw Chart

Tube Color Additive Tests‌ Commonly Conducted
Yellow Sodium Polyanethol Sulfonate (SPS) Bacterial cultures
Light Blue Citrate Coagulation tests (PT, APTT)
Red No additive Routine blood services, Serology
Gold/Tiger Top Gel⁢ separator Serum ⁤tests
Green Sodium heparin or lithium​ heparin Plasma tests
Lavender EDTA Complete‍ blood count⁤ (CBC)
Gray Fluoride Glucose⁤ tolerance tests

Practical Tips for Triumphant Blood collection

Here are some ⁢practical​ tips to help ​you master phlebotomy and ensure accurate blood collection:

  • Planning: Ensure you‌ have all necessary supplies, including gloves, antiseptic wipes, ​needles, and appropriate collection tubes.
  • Patient Identification: Always verify the patient’s identity and confirm the ⁢tests to be performed.
  • Site Selection: Choose the appropriate vein, typically the median cubital⁣ vein, and​ prepare the⁣ site with ​antiseptic.
  • Follow the⁣ Order ⁤of Draw: ‍ Adhere strictly to the⁣ order of draw to‌ avoid contamination and ensure accurate results.
  • Post-Collection Care: Apply pressure and bandage the site promptly to prevent bleeding.

Common mistakes to Avoid

while ‌mastering phlebotomy, it’s essential to recognize and avoid ⁣common mistakes:

  • Not⁤ Following the‍ Order of⁢ Draw: Ignoring this crucial step can result‍ in contamination.
  • Improper Site Preparation: Insufficient cleaning ⁢of the venipuncture area ‍may introduce bacteria into the‌ sample.
  • Using⁤ Expired Collection Tubes: Always check the expiration date on your supplies⁢ before use.
